Most influential criticism
On Photography by Susan Sontag
Classic collection of essays exploring the moral and aesthetic implications of photography.
- Thought-provoking and influential
- Concise and readable
- Timeless insights
- Some essays feel dated
- Not a practical guide

Best philosophical work
Camera Lucida: Reflections on Photography by Roland Barthes
A deeply personal and philosophical meditation on photography, introducing concepts like 'punctum'.
- Unique perspective on photography
- Influential concepts
- Short and profound
- Abstract and subjective
- Not for practical learning
